Psychologists can not practice acupuncture, decides STJ

Brasilia - The Superior Court of Justice (STJ) decided this week to prohibit psychologists use acupuncture as a complementary technique of treatment for their patients, since, according to the court, the practice is not required by law regulating psychology (Law 4.119/62 .) The decision of the Supreme Court confirmed the judgment of the Federal Court of the 1st Region 5, which annulled the resolution 2002 of the Federal Council of Psychology (CFP), which expanded the playing field for professionals, enabling the use of acupuncture treatments.

The minister Napoleon Nunes Maia Filho, STJ, recognizes that in the country there is no legislation prohibiting the practice of acupuncture by certain professionals or provides specifically who can work in the area, but for him it does not allow, by means of an act administrative, psychologists assign its category this practice. The minister explained that the practice of acupuncture depend on express statutory authorization, to be identical to invasive medical procedure, "even minimally." "You can not, by administrative act, resolution of the Federal Council of Psychology, remedy the vacuum of law," said Maia Filho in a statement.

In response to the decision, the PAC sent a special appeal to the Federal Supreme Court (STF) asking for your makeover. In a statement, the organization explains that "the psychologist, from professional assignments printed in Law No. 4.119/62, uses acupuncture as a complementary resource to their professional activity. And it's why the Federal Council of Psychology CFP issued Resolution No. 005/2002, as powers delegated to it by Article 1 of Law No. 5.766/71 [Creation System Board]. "

The Brazilian Society of Psychology and Acupuncture (Sobrapa) estimates that, in Brazil, approximately 4000 psychology professionals offer this treatment technique to their patients. Under the CFP, the Ministry of Health recognizes acupuncture in primary care exercised by Professional Psychology.

Under the CFP, acupuncture is an ancient therapeutic method, an integral part of traditional Chinese medicine. The organization argues that "this perspective, we can say that the practice, which is based on philosophical, is not used for medical treatment by a psychologist or physician, as suggested by the decision of the Supreme Court, but rather from a psychological diagnosis."
"If a patient arrives at the office of a psychologist to treat heart disease, the professional may not be used for this purpose of acupuncture and refer the patient to a doctor," says the appeal by the board.
